Pariaman Utara District has the most extensive mangrove forest, which is 16.5 ha, in Apar Village the amount (6.0 ha). The purpose of this study was to determine the type and density of mangrove forests and to determine the condition of mangrove forests by determining the percentage of canopy cover in Apar Village. The method used in this research is a survey method, where the data collected is data obtained directly from the field which is then analyzed the data. The research procedure consisted of several stages, namely, collecting density data at 3 stations. Each station consisted of 3 straight line transects along 50 meters from the sea and estuary to land with a position perpendicular to the coast and having a distance between transect lines of 50 meters. In each transect line there are 3 plots arranged in a zigzag manner with a size of 10 m x 10 m for the tree category mangrove community structure. Retrieval of canopy cover photo data which was then analyzed by hemispherical photography. The results of measurements of water quality from the research location were temperature 29 - 30 ° C, salinity 4 - 5 ‰ and pH of the waters were 6-7. The composition of mangroves in the research locations were Sonneratia caseolaris, Sonneratia alba, Rhizophora mucronata, Nypa fructicans. Density at station I, 1700.00 trees/ha, station II 1311.11 trees/ha and station III 1888.89 trees/ha. Canopy cover at station I, 80.65%, station II, 58.46% and station III, 83.21%.
